High Prices and New Trade Keep Russian Fuel Revenues Afloat

Bridget Ryder June 27, 2022

India and the Middle East have become a significant outlet for Russia crude oil sales, as well as a loophole for the US and European countries to continue importing Russian oil.

Portugal Creates New Work Visa

Bridget Ryder June 27, 2022

“This allows foreign nationals to enter Portuguese territory who have come looking for work for a period of 120 days, extended to another 60 days, for a total of 180 days,” Minister of Parliamentary Affairs Ana Catarina Mendes clarified.
